University of Wyoming

Laramie, Wyoming
#1 in overall quality

You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end University of Wyoming. The school came in at #1 for the Best Value Computer Science Schools for a Bachelor’s in Wyoming For Those Making $75-$110k. UW is a fairly large public school situated in Laramie, Wyoming. It awarded 44 bachelors’s computer science degrees in 2019-2020.

In addition to being on our wyoming bachelor’s degree computer science students whose families make $75-$110k list, UW has also earned the #1 rank in our “Best Computer Science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Wyoming” ranking. The yearly cost to attend University of Wyoming is $14,958 for wyoming bachelor’s degree computer science students whose families make $75-$110k.

The low student loan default rate of 4.5% is a good sign that students have an easier time paying off their loans than they might at other schools. For comparison, the national default rate is 10.1%.
